Still needed more dirt to fill the hole left by the Coddington & Laird fire in 1933, The house, 116 2nd St. NW, just past the alley is still there in 2025. It previously served as a parsonage, but has long been a private home. Construction, a key word search, isn't exactly correct since a new building was still years away. The corner was a hole in the ground from 1933 once the rubble was removed until 1958 when it was leveled off dirt. Then it was an empty lot until 1969.
